SPCA Wild ARC

Description:

The mission of the BC SPCA Wild Animal Rehabilitation Centre (Wild ARC) is to provide care to injured, sick, orphaned and distressed wildlife based on rehabilitation standards and the animal's natural history. We treat each animal in our care as an individual case. The goal of rehabilitation is to release recovered animals back into the wild. Human activity affects over 80 percent of the animals treated at Wild ARC. We aim to reduce this impact, and educate the public about wildlife, animal welfare and co-existing with nature.
